Transaction 58381dc53ef98144d3052802c494f5f87b61fcb12d3fc32f1b40d3e1c1ed1925
1 Input
1 Output
-
58381dc53ef98144d3052802c494f5f87b61fcb12d3fc32f1b40d3e1c1ed1925:0
- value
- 138177009
- script pubkey
- OP_0 OP_PUSHBYTES_20 fdd2c9b438e501f75eeacc0ede9f716acb198fe6
- address
- bc1qlhfvndpcu5qlwhh2es8da8m3dt93nrlxhwh5qg